Grandpa's Barn

I'm excited to announce that my picture book story, Grandpa's Barn, beautifully illustrated by Victoria Marble, has an April 29, 2025, release date.

Publisher, Roan & Weatherford Publishing/Young Dragons Press.

Synopsis: In Grandpa's Barn a curious child embarks on a sensory adventure, discovering the sights, sounds and wonders of farm life with Grandpa. Each stall holds a delightful surprise, leading to a heartwarming final discovery. A timeless tale of love, curiosity, and the joy of shared moments!

I dedicated this book to my grandpa Anton Reiser. As a child, I loved exploring his barn.

HAPPY BOOK BIRTHDAY TO GRANDPA'S BARN!

Book birth announcement: IT'S A PICTURE BOOK!

Debra Daugherty, author, and Victoria Marble, illustrator, are proud to announce the arrival of their latest picture book. Debra and Victoria are also the co-creators of The Memory Jar.

Name: Grandpa's Barn
Date of birth/Pub date: April 29, 2025, 12:00 AM
Place of birth/Publisher: Roan & Weatherford Publishing/Young Dragons.
Pages: 24
Size: 8.5" X 8.5" X 0.06"
Weight: 2.09 ounces
ISBN-10: 1633739155
ISBN-13: 9781633739154
Reading ages: 5-9 years
List Price: $10.99 Paperback
Grandpa's Barn is available on Amazon and Barnes & Noble's websites.

Synopsis: In GRANDPA’S BARN a curious child embarks on a sensory adventure, discovering the sights, sounds and wonders of farm life with Grandpa. Each stall holds a delightful surprise, leading to a heartwarming final discovery. A timeless tale of love, curiosity, and the joy of shared moments!

I dedicated Grandpa's Barn to my grandpa, Anton Reiser. As a child, I loved exploring his barn, playing in his hayloft, and finding surprises in the stalls, such as baby piglets and kittens.

I'm thankful to two amazing authors who read Grandpa's Barn in advance and wrote blurbs for the back cover, Alice McGinty and Lori Degman. Here is what they wrote:

“This engaging evocative story will immerse you in the sights, sounds, and smells of GRANDPA’S BARN as well as the warmth of his love.” Alice McGinty, author of BATHE THE CAT and A STORY FOR SMALL BEAR.

“Told with vivid sensory details and rich-toned illustrations, this sweet story of a girl, her grandpa, and their shared love of his barn will pull you in and warm your heart!” Lori Degman, author of LIKE A GIRL, COCK-A-DOODLE-OOPS! and TRAVEL GUIDE FOR MONSTERS.
